About Hiroto Kato
Hiroto Kato is a scholar working on Civil and Structural Engineering, Building and Construction, Computational Mechanics, Genetics and Neurology, having authored 13 papers that have together received 460 indexed citations. Recurring topics across this work include Structural Behavior of Reinforced Concrete (4 papers), Structural Load-Bearing Analysis (4 papers), Computational Fluid Dynamics and Aerodynamics (3 papers), Structural Engineering and Vibration Analysis (2 papers), Combustion and flame dynamics (2 papers), Flow Measurement and Analysis (1 paper), Meningioma and schwannoma management (1 paper) and Structural Response to Dynamic Loads (1 paper). The work is most often cited by research in Civil and Structural Engineering (227 citations), Mechanical Engineering (387 citations), Control and Systems Engineering (212 citations), Ocean Engineering (74 citations) and Computational Mechanics (41 citations). Hiroto Kato has collaborated with scholars based in Japan, Germany and United States. Frequent co-authors include Masayoshi Nakashima, Eiji Takaoka, Satoru Yamamoto, Koichi Kusunoki, Takashi Hasegawa, Masanori Tani, Hiroshi Fukuyama, Tetsuyoshi Horiuchi, Tetsuya Goto and Kazuhiro Hongo. Their work appears in journals such as Journal of Structural and Construction Engineering (Transactions of AIJ), Journal of Structural Engineering, Neurologia medico-chirurgica, Bulletin of the New Zealand Society for Earthquake Engineering and Earthquake Engineering & Structural Dynamics.
